Immerse yourself in the tranquil beauty of Shark Bay in Feijoal, Cape Verde — a raw, serene coastal landscape where the endless sandy beach meets wild rocky shores under a soft, cloud-dappled sky. Feel the soothing sounds of gentle waves and the vast openness that invites quiet reflection and soul-soothing escape. This hidden gem offers travel enthusiasts a perfect blend of peaceful nature and rugged charm, inspiring moments of mindful retreat far from the bustling crowds. Let Shark Bay awaken your senses and rejuvenate your spirit in one of Cape Verde’s most authentic coastal havens.

The nearest airport is Aristides Pereira International Airport (BVC), approximately 25 minutes by car from Shark Bay.
